I would run what I can under 1 worker process / app pool.
I don't see any reason not too.
You servers don't seem very busy. You should easily be about to cope with 65 ppl on your servers at once.
You should be about to do thousands.
Overall you will need to look at why things are slow or you. often this is the db bottleneck but look for slow running pages and optimize them.
Online tools like stackify and leansentry will help too.
